A beloved landmark of the Sand Hills golfing mecca, the Pinehurst Country Club is a capacious and picturesque building of concrete and tile, designed in a hospitable Mediterrannean style with arcaded porches overlooking the golf courses. Here is the nationally renowned Pinehurst No. 2 Course (1901, 1935) planned by Donald Ross.
